What "Minimally Invasive" Really Indicates in Modern Aesthetics

"Minimally invasive" obtains utilized a great deal, but in aesthetic medication it has a details meaning. A minimally invasive cosmetic treatment typically includes small shots, micro-incisions, or concentrated energy such as lasers or radiofrequency-- as opposed to large incisions and typical surgery. In Michigan, therapies like Botox injections, dermal fillers, microneedling, chemical peels, and laser resurfacing are all taken into consideration minimally invasive choices. They generally call for just topical numbing or light regional anesthesia, and a lot of people can drive home and resume regular activities the same day.

These techniques are made to enhance, not drastically change, your attributes. As opposed to looking "done," the objective is to smooth creases, soften lines, bring back shed quantity, tighten mild skin laxity, and improve shapes in such a way that fits your all-natural anatomy. That's why matching minimally invasive modern technology with a cosmetic surgeon experienced in facial aesthetics and body contouring issues so much. The devices-- like lasers, injectables, and power devices-- are only component of the picture; the genuine magic depend on specialist assessment, preparation, and accuracy. Popular Minimally Invasive Face Treatments in Michigan

When individuals first discover minimally invasive procedures in Michigan, they frequently start with the face. It's the most noticeable part of us and generally where aging shows up initially. Usual worries consist of temple lines, crow's feet, frown lines between the eyebrows, under-eye hollows, sagging cheeks, or a softening jawline. Therapies like Botox and similar neuromodulators can kick back overactive muscle mass that cause expression lines, while hyaluronic acid dermal fillers can bring back the quantity lost in the cheeks, lips, and around the mouth. One of the biggest benefits of these injectable therapies is that they're customizable-- your provider can dial outcomes up or down relying on whether you want a really refined refresh or a more visible renovation.

Past injectables, Michigan people are significantly turning to non-surgical face rejuvenation like laser skin resurfacing, intense pulsed light (IPL), and medical-grade chemical peels off to take on sunlight damage, age places, bigger pores, and irregular appearance. Microneedling, usually integrated with radiofrequency or platelet-rich plasma (PRP), helps to boost collagen manufacturing, bring about firmer skin in time. For those bothered with early jowling or a soft jawline, non-surgical skin tightening up around the reduced face and neck can gently strong tissues without an incision. The goal with every one of these choices is to keep an all-natural appearance-- freshened, well-rested, and confident-- so buddies might notice you look excellent but can't quite put their finger on why.

Body Contouring & & Skin Tightening Up Without Major Surgery

It's not just encounters benefiting from minimally invasive techniques. Several Michigan residents seek non-surgical body contouring alternatives after weight changes, maternities, or just thanks to persistent locations that don't reply to diet and workout. Modern body-sculpting devices can target tiny pockets of fat on the abdominal area, flanks, upper legs, arms, and under the chin. These treatments normally use regulated cooling, warm, or radiofrequency power to harm fat cells, which are after that naturally eliminated by the body gradually. Downtime is minimal-- often simply a little momentary swelling or inflammation-- so you can still enjoy a weekend break at Heritage Park or a stroll around Forest Hills Nature Park without a long recuperation.

Along with fat decrease, numerous minimally invasive treatments concentrate on skin tightening and cellulite smoothing After weight loss or maternity, skin doesn't constantly "break back" as much as we would certainly such as. Radiofrequency and ultrasound-based gadgets can promote collagen deeper in the skin, progressively boosting suppleness and elasticity. While these treatments will not replace a full tummy tuck or medical lift for everybody, they can be ideal for those with moderate to modest laxity that intend to stay clear of scars and extended downtime. Planning Your Personal Minimally Invasive Treatment Roadmap

One of the very best means to approach minimally invasive treatments is to believe in terms of a roadmap instead of a one-off treatment. Throughout your consultation, you'll likely speak about your short-term worries (possibly softening forehead lines before a get-together or boosting your jawline for upcoming pictures) and your long-term objectives (like keeping company, glowing skin into your 40s, 50s, and past). From there, your company can suggest a phased strategy that spreads treatments out with time, maintaining each go to convenient while developing results that last. As an example, you may start with Botox and a light chemical peel, after that include microneedling or laser treatments a few months later, followed by critical fillers once your skin top quality has actually boosted.

Maintenance is likewise component of the discussion. Several minimally invasive therapies in Michigan function best when done at normal intervals-- Botox every 3 to four months, filler yearly or more, skin rejuvenation once or twice a year, and a constant home-care routine with medical-grade skin care in between.
